Handmade Background #2

Hi Everyone! Welcome to my blog. I am back with my handmade background series, card #2! I have decided that I will post this series of cards on the 2nd and 4th Wednesdays so that I don't interfere with other challenges.

I wouldn't really call this one a handmade background, but I did choose the color of foil to go on this background. I started with a snowflake printed background, used a multi -colored foil of silver and teal and ran it through my laminator.



You can see the shimmer of the foil and the sparkle on the snowman better in this picture.


The image is from a retired Penny Black set called To All.... This set is new to me because I bought a few retired sets at a stamp show recently.  It was colored with alcohol markers. I used the Wink of Stella clear glitter pen on the sonwman's body and a silver paint pen on his skates. The image was cut out using the Gina Marie stitched circle die.

Handmade Background Card #1

Hi and welcome to my blog. I hope you had a Happy New Year! Each year I have a series on my blog so that I can try to use up my many craft items! I know I never will, but I try to make a dent anyway. LOL! I will show my background cards every 2nd and 4th Tuesday. I hope that you will drop by often to take a peek.

This year's series will be all about backgrounds. I love trying techniques and I have made hundreds of card backgrounds. I am starting off with a fun background that I made using acrylic paints.


For this background I swiped purple, blue and white paints over the card in a horizontal and vertical direction using a credit card. After it dried I brayered some white paint on bubble wrap and patted it on the swiped background.

I used an image a stamping friend sent me. I colored the scarf and carrot nose with alcohol markers. I added Sparkle embossing powder to the snowman's body. He was cut out using the Gina Marie stitched circle die. The snowflake is a Cuttlebug die and clear Stickles glitter was added to it for sparkle.

Take Flight

Hi and welcome to my blog. Happy New Year! I want to show you a card I made using a new to me technique that I discovered recently and a new inside fold.



On the front of this card I started by scribbling around the leafy stencil using watercolor crayons. I then spritzed the stencil with water, turned the stencil over on the colored side and placed it on watercolor paper. I patted the stencil a little and let it stay on the paper a few seconds and then lifted off the stencil. This left a pretty watercolored background. 

Next I stamped and colored one of my favorite stamps from the BoBunny Butterfly Kisses stamp set. It was fussy cut and added over the background.

Here is the picture of the inside of the card where I used a strip of card stock to make folds so that the stamped images would pop up. These butterflies are a Stampabilities stamp. I have been using these butterflies a lot lately on my cards. It seems I use birds and butterflies a lot!
